Emotion and the Law: Psychological Perspectives - Nebraska Symposium on Motivation Brian H Bornstein 2010 edition
Emotion and the Law: Psychological Perspectives - Nebraska Symposium on Motivation
Brian H Bornstein
This book brings social psychology into sharp forensic focus. Emotion, mood and affective states, plus patterns of conduct that tend to arise from them, are analyzed in theoretical and practical terms, using real-life examples from criminal and civil cases.
